The History of Noodles

Before we jump into the magazine itself, let’s take a quick trip through time. The history of noodles is as rich and varied as the dishes themselves. Archaeologists have found evidence of noodles dating back to the Bronze Age in China, and they’ve been a staple in Asian cuisine ever since. But noodles didn’t stop there—they traveled the world, adapting to new cultures and cuisines along the way.

In Europe, pasta became a cornerstone of Italian cuisine, with countless shapes and sizes to suit every taste. Meanwhile, in Southeast Asia, dishes like pad thai and laksa became culinary icons. And let’s not forget the global phenomenon of instant noodles, which revolutionized how people eat on the go.

Regional Noodle Specialties

Every region has its own take on noodles, and Noodles magazine highlights these specialties. For example:

  • In Italy, you’ll find regional variations like gnocchi in the north and orecchiette in the south.
  • In China, each province has its own signature noodle dish, from the spicy dan dan noodles of Sichuan to the delicate wonton noodles of Hong Kong.
  • In Southeast Asia, dishes like pho from Vietnam and mee goreng from Malaysia showcase the region’s love for bold flavors.

The Science Behind Perfect Noodles

For those of you who are scientifically inclined, Noodles magazine also covers the science behind making the perfect noodle. From the gluten content in wheat noodles to the cooking techniques that bring out the best flavors, there’s a lot to learn. Understanding the science can help you elevate your noodle game, whether you’re a home cook or a professional chef.

Here are a few key scientific insights:

  • Gluten gives wheat noodles their elasticity and chewiness.
  • Al dente pasta is cooked just enough to retain a slight firmness, enhancing texture.
  • Adding eggs to noodles can improve their flavor and texture.

Noodles in Popular Culture

Noodles have made their way into popular culture in a big way. From movies to TV shows, they’ve become a symbol of comfort and community. Noodles magazine explores this cultural impact, offering readers a chance to see how noodles have influenced art, music, and even fashion.

For example:

  • The movie "Tampopo" is a comedic ode to ramen, showcasing its cultural significance in Japan.
  • In anime and manga, noodles often appear as a symbol of friendship and shared experiences.
  • Even in Western media, noodles have become a staple, with shows like "The Sopranos" featuring classic Italian pasta dishes.

These cultural references highlight just how much noodles have become a part of our collective consciousness.

Health Benefits of Noodles

Contrary to popular belief, noodles can be part of a healthy diet. Noodles magazine highlights the nutritional benefits of different noodle types, offering readers a chance to make informed choices. For example:

  • Whole grain noodles are high in fiber and can help with digestion.
  • Soba noodles are rich in protein and essential amino acids.
  • Shirataki noodles are low in calories and carbs, making them a great option for those watching their weight.
